Default Ground Wires

What do you guys think about those ground wire kits? HKS, Apexi or even those Ebay ones?

Do they really make a difference? Because Im really looking into buying them

They'll make well less difference on a car on California than a car in Michigan. I wouldn't consider one unless A) you've run out of mods in your autox/road race/drag class, or b) your stock ground straps are corroded beyond recognition.

Buying a ground wire kit is pointless. Your factory grounds were put where they are for a reason. Your best option though if your OE is corroded is to replace them with a larger gauge wire. Try a 4 gauge wire on your battery to ground and your block and tranny grounds. It isn't really a huge HP gain, but your engine and car will really like this. And for all the guys with huge stereo amps, this is a good investment to consider.

yes, people tend to forget that with a huge stereo, you are overworking the battery and alternator. its good to upgrade the wiring. and aside from the wires that Pawpawsmurph mentioned, upgrade the alternator wiring also.
